Output 616bbcc8e8f4e1090d7cd0ccd3a90b925774700b7ee75546185d1cdbefa0b855:79

value
66991674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c052f8bcd4913ac4f7909db67906329672efdc7f OP_EQUAL
address
3KDw4LyXNGmtbPCQKhKfZbUjm1wtkhpTDd
transaction
616bbcc8e8f4e1090d7cd0ccd3a90b925774700b7ee75546185d1cdbefa0b855
spent
true